Top Career Paths for Writers in 2027

Writing is no longer limited to journalism or publishing. In 2027, the intersection of technology and communication has created high-value roles that prioritize clarity, user experience, and strategic messaging. For students and career changers, the most lucrative opportunities lie in sectors that integrate writing with digital product development and corporate strategy.

When selecting a path, evaluate the role based on industry demand rather than just creative output. Roles like UX Writing involve crafting the micro-copy within apps, while Technical Writing focuses on translating complex engineering documentation into user-friendly manuals. Both roles are currently experiencing a surge in demand as companies prioritize digital transformation. Unlike traditional freelance writing, these roles offer structured corporate benefits, clear promotion ladders, and consistent income streams that scale with experience and specialization.

Key Points for Students
  • ✓UX Writing: Focuses on user journey and interface clarity.
  • ✓Technical Writing: Specializes in complex documentation for engineering/SaaS.
  • ✓Content Strategy: Focuses on long-term brand storytelling and SEO performance.
  • ✓Corporate Communications: Manages internal/external stakeholder messaging.

Verifying Career Growth and Salary Benchmarks

According to 2026 industry outlook reports and NASSCOM-aligned data, the demand for specialized writers has decoupled from generalist content creation. While AI tools have automated basic copywriting, the market for high-level editorial strategy and technical documentation has grown by 15% year-over-year. Institutional placement reports from top media and technology institutes indicate that graduates with dual skills—writing plus a technical domain—command 30% higher starting packages than those with pure creative degrees.

Verified placement data from leading institutes confirms that top-tier companies in the SaaS and FinTech sectors are actively recruiting for 'Content Designers' and 'Information Architects.' These roles require a blend of linguistic precision and analytical research, often verified through professional certifications or portfolios that demonstrate measurable impact on business KPIs.

Frequently Asked Questions

Clear answers to common student admission questions

Is a creative writing degree worth it in 2027?
A creative writing degree is valuable if paired with technical certifications or digital marketing skills. It provides the foundational storytelling ability, but industry-specific training is required for high-paying corporate roles.
Which writing career pays the most?
Content Strategy and UX Writing currently offer the highest salary brackets, often exceeding ₹15-18 LPA for experienced professionals in the tech sector.
Does AI threaten writing careers?
AI has automated entry-level copywriting, but it has increased the demand for high-level content strategists and technical writers who can verify, curate, and humanize AI-generated output.
